Maulana Tariq Jamil is in sound health as he returns home

Well-known religious scholar Maulana Tariq Jamil, who had tested negative for Coronavirus, has returned home after recovering with good health.

In his message on Twitter, he extends thankfulness to all his well-wishers and also prayed for patients battling with the deadly COVID-19 disease.

Earlier, The religious scholar said that he had tested negative for the virus and had requested followers to remember him in their prayers. “May Allah let humanity get rid of this pandemic with His blessings,” he prayed.

Tariq Jamil was born on 1 October 1953 in Mian Channu, Pakistan. He completed primary education from Central Model School, Lahore. Jamil is an alumnus of Government College University.

He received his Islamic education from Jamia Arabia, Raiwind, where he studied Qur’an, Hadith, Sufism, logic, and Islamic jurisprudence.

In 2019, the religious scholar stood 40th of a list ranking the world’s most “influential” Muslims.
